Recognizing Residential Plumbing: A Comprehensive Guide

Residential pipes is an important element of home maintenance and performance, including the system of pipes, components, and drainage which enables a residence to have running water and waste elimination. Recognizing the fundamentals of household plumbing can equip house owners to make educated choices regarding upkeep, repair work, and upgrades. In this guide, we will discover the vital components of property pipes, usual issues, upkeep suggestions, and when to call a professional.

The plumbing system in a normal home can be broken down right into two key categories: the water supply system and the water drainage system. The water system brings fresh water into the home and is usually composed of pipes made from products such as copper, PVC, or PEX. This system includes necessary components like taps, commodes, and showerheads. On the other hand, the water drainage system is in charge of eliminating wastewater from the home. It consists of drains and vents that make sure proper water flow and avoid sewage system gases from entering the living space.

As with any kind of home system, pipes can deal with a range of issues with time. Typical issues consist of leakages, clogs, and low tide stress. Leaks, which can occur because of deterioration, typically manifest in moist spots on wall surfaces or ceilings, and can lead to significant damage if not dealt with quickly. Blockages may create in sinks, toilets, and shower drains pipes, reducing or completely halting water circulation. Low water stress, typically brought on by mineral accumulation in pipes, can influence the general water system throughout the home. Identifying these concerns early can save house owners money and time in repairs.

Normal upkeep of residential pipes is essential to preventing major concerns down the line. House owners need to occasionally inspect pipes for indications of deterioration or leakages, clean tap aerators and showerheads to prevent mineral build-up, and guarantee that drains pipes are clear of particles. It’s also a good idea to schedule specialist pipes inspections a minimum of once a year. These safety nets can assist keep a healthy and balanced pipes system, boost water effectiveness, and extend the lifespan of plumbing components.

While many pipes jobs can be managed by persistent property owners, some situations call for the experience of a professional plumbing. If you experience relentless leaks, extreme blockages that will not clear, or any kind of plumbing emergencies such as flooding, it is vital to seek assistance from a licensed plumbing. Attempting complex fixings without the essential experience can lead to more damage and enhanced expenses. Comprehending when to call an expert is a vital element of handling residential plumbing efficiently.
